Stefania is a Senior Associate at Fragomen’s Melbourne office. She has more than 10 years of corporate immigration and policy analysis experience gained in both Australia and the UK. Stefania assists corporate clients in the engineering, resources, agriculture, information technology, banking and health care industries with a variety of immigration applications, including complex health waiver matters, character issues, family visas and Global Talent visas.

Stefania first joined Fragomen in 2016 and has held various roles within the firm, including at Fragomen’s Dublin office, where she assisted businesses in relocating their employees to Ireland. She also worked at Fragomen’s London office as a Senior Advisor in the client services team, where she acted as a single point of contact on global client accounts for queries and service issues. She has represented the firm in client pitch negotiations and taken the lead on client business reviews.

Prior to joining Fragomen, Stefania began her career training at a specialist immigration law firm in Victoria, Australia. While in Australia, Stefania was a volunteer at Refugee Legal where she provided legal assistance to a large number of refugees fleeing persecution.

Stefania speaks English, French and Italian.
